Output 3a1434469717af0b179432727902116e1da7ace36798026454f1329533c0f848:3

value
8950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40a315ce0e23af36b9005e2163590269f9862b88 OP_EQUAL
address
37anYBFVnZr3933D9pf3A8ohX3zJ46Gx83
transaction
3a1434469717af0b179432727902116e1da7ace36798026454f1329533c0f848
spent
true